| |||
como guardar una fecha en mysql.. Hola amigos, quiero un consego como puedo guardar la fecha en una tabla y de que tipo debe de ser el campo, lo puedo poner de tipo char o date, o ustedes como me aconsejan, por que despues necesito imprimir los registros de los ultimos 3 dias, y no se como crear mi tabla ni como recuperar los datos con la condicion de ultimos 3 dias, gracias |
| ||||
yo estoy liado con algo parecido, te aconsejo que uses un campo date para guardar la fecha te ayudara, yo cometi el fallo de crear el campo tipo text, y tuve que rehacer todo y volver a meter las fechas.
__________________ Foro de futbol andaluz, todos los equipos de futbol de Andalucia |
| ||||
Tan solo unos post arriba: http://www.forosdelweb.com/f18/porque-no-guarda-fecha-318450/ Agrego que la query para consultar los registros de los últimos 3 días, teniendo un campo tipo DATE (igual puedes usar uno DATETIME, todo depende de tus requerimentos) sería:
Código:
Brevemente explico que CURDATE() nos da la fecha actual y con DATE_SUB() restamos 3 días a dicha fecha, entonces solo recuperamos los registros que coincidan ó que sean superiores a ese resultado...SELECT campos FROM tabla WHERE campofecha>= DATE_SUB(CURDATE(), INTERVAL 3 DAY) Recomiendo los artículos de www.mysql-hispano.org . Suerte!
__________________ ٩(͡๏̯͡๏)۶ "100 años después, la revolución no es con armas, es intelectual y digital" |